Frequently Asked Questions
The tool extracts all meta tags including title, description, keywords, Open Graph tags (og:title, og:description, og:image, etc.), Twitter Card tags, and other standard meta tags found on the page.
The results are provided in structured JSON format, organized into sections: title, meta (standard tags), openGraph (Open Graph tags), and twitter (Twitter Card tags).
Yes, you can copy the JSON to clipboard or download it as a JSON file for easy import into SEO tools or for further analysis.
If no meta tags are found, it could mean the page doesn't have meta tags, or they might be dynamically loaded. Try checking the page source manually or use the OmniScraper extension for more advanced extraction capabilities.
